- the southern christian leadership conference: recognizing the need for a mass movement to capitalize on the successful montgomery action, king set about organizing the southern christian leadership conference (sclc), which gave him a base of operation throughout the south, as well as a national platform from which to speak.
Southern men developed a code to ritualize their interactions with each other and to perform their expectations of honor. This code structured language and behavior and was designed to minimize conflict. But when conflict did arise, the code also provided rituals that would reduce the resulting violence.

Kinnaman describes three types of disengagement from the church among young christians—nomads, prodigals, and exiles. Nomads generally believe that involvement in a christian community is optional, readily admit that their faith was more important in years prior than the present, and are spiritually eclectic (64-65).

King also distinguishes his movement, the southern christian leadership conference, from other desegregationist movements led by blacks “who have absolutely repudiated christianity,” such as the nation of islam. Again, this helps king to portray himself as a christian leader seeking racial equality, rather than simply as a racial agitator.

The normans had been expanding south, as mercenaries and adventurers, driven by the myth of a happy and sunny island in the southern seas. The norman robert guiscard, son of tancred, invaded sicily in 1060. The island was split politically between three arab emirs, and the sizable byzantine christian population rebelled against the ruling muslims.

Using early christian adaptations of late roman styles, the byzantines developed a new visual language, expressing the ritual and dogma of the united church and state. Early on variants flourished in alexandria and antioch, but increasingly the imperial bureaucracy undertook the major commissions, and artists were sent out to the regions.
